Film Overview
With droves of Romanians seeking to exit the country, Irish conman Mickey Moynihan devises the perfect plan to make cash. After charming the Irish Consul in Romania over a few pints, Mickey only has to convince him that 41 random Romanians are invited to an Irish music festival – as an acclaimed gypsy choir. While working out the details of his scam to make money off of the visas, Mickey crosses paths with Catalina, a young woman whose father has lost her in a bet to the ringleader of the Gypsy Mafia. Desperate to flee, Catalina has gone to “The Frenchman,” a madman who can get anyone a Visa – at a price. In the end, Mickey and his cohorts are dealing with far more than the good-natured Consul and 41 tone-deaf Romanians. Clever cinematography, an astonishingly fast pace, and a spot-on soundtrack make this a funny and engrossing film. In addition to being based on a real immigration scam, WHAT MEANS MOTLEY? stars the Honorary Irish Consul of Romania, who also co-wrote and co-produced the film. (In English and Romanian with English sutbitles) – J.B.H.
